How to submit games to the RPG Maker Pavilion - Updated 3/5/2014

1. Select the forum that supports your submission

2. Select "New Thread".

3. For the "Title", put your game's title. ONLY your game's title.

4. In the "Message" field, describe your game's story, features, and any other information you believe is relevant.

5. If your game is a console RPG Maker game or demo, you're able to upload it directly to the site. If it's a PC RPG Maker game or demo, you'll have to upload it elsewhere and link to it here. If uploading a console game, under "Additional Options", there is an option for "Attach Files". Select "manage attachments". If you're submitting a PC RPG Maker game, you can still upload screenshots.

6. Click browse to find the game file on your computer, and click "Upload". all files MUST be zipped. You're able to upload ten attachments to your submission post. The ideal way to use these is to use one attachment for the game console's native format (dex drive or max drive), a second for a PS3 format save file, and the remaining slots for screenshots or other extra material you want to accompany your game.

7. If you need to update your game, simply edit it's submission post at any time. You can check the site's game directory to see how your game will appear in the listings after each edit. Try to make it fit in with the rest. No huge or colorful text, no images posted in the top of the post that appears in the directory, just general things like that.

8. Only one submission thread per game, unless the differences between the versions are drastic enough that it warrants having multiple versions available, such as a director's cut, or an alternate version with different features.

9. If you have a converted file for someone else's game, please post that in the conversions subforum at the bottom of the submission subforum listing.

10. Everything posted in the submission forums appears immediately on the site, so don't make a post without having your game ready to go up with it. These will be deleted on-sight by the staff.

    Crystal Shores -Chapter 1-3

    Four people from four periods of time fight to resolve their inner demons; whether it's discovering ones place in the world, reconciling past mistakes, desiring normalcy, or realizing the value of humanity. Though separated by time, deep undercurrents link their struggle to discover why humanity failed.

    Throughout the game the player learns how each layer of time, each historical event affects the central theme of change, regret, and choice. Even with firm knowledge of the past are you able to change what has happened, come to grips with what is happening, or be able to make hard choices that could alter or even erase your own existence?

    The greatest difficulty may not be changing the past, but changing the past within you.

    Card Three Released!

    Some of what's in the 3 chapters.

    Minigames
    -card flip game
    -Tekken style fighting game that not as good as takes
    -pokerish (10 card, nothing more complex then a house i think)
    -hi low game that works with the pokerish game to increase your bet
    -propositions for some fun jobs a la tactics that will reward you
    -make a fake report and earn a prize
    -several kinds of smash or avoid stuff mini games and one cannon shot avoiding thingy

    Big Features
    -You can swap from the into card (bonus features) from the main character select and the end of each card. This allows you to access a party re equip section, a party switch place to be able to equip everyone, a place to spend complete keys for great loot (like ff4 legendary weapon room?), and a multi stat item equipping room. Each card you complete will unlock a new feature for a total of 8 features to unlock.

    -You of course can select to play any of the 4 members of the main story arc in any order you want. I will tell you now that this has massive ramifications on how your game experience is because of plot and the items you get in one playthrough. In the future I could complicate it further by having exclusive scenes depending on the order of your choice but that's for the future.

    -The magic duplicator doors that everyone likes is still outrageously rich but also balanced to not give insane items unless you sacrifice for them. In other words the duplicator keys will not always be enough to loot every item.

    -I have a cheater set for anyone who hates battles so they can play the game with instant victory battles to speed up the game. There is only one point that has a random battles in the game and I clearly mention it in game so you can avoid battles if you want too. If you lose a battle there is increasing penalties but the game still reserves the right to hit you with a bad pun or some shenanigans.

    -Every enemy has different choices depending if you beat them or not. Some enemies are well worth not defeating (loosing to them) while others offer you a great reward if you have the tenacity to beat them.

    -Contrary to previous thoughts the choices in my game do make an impact. Its not very noticeable now and admittedly Ive used the decisions you made only a few times but some NPCs do say different things and certain scenes are different too. As the later cards come out you will see the ramifications in plain sight.

    -Plenty of interactive events. I have lavished events on anything that looked like it would be good to add a comment on. You can find treasure in hidden places, a funny note about a stump, or learn the back history of a displaced society. Your characters talk and make comments on things too so you will feel their personality. Click on everything and you will most likely be rewarded for your effort.

    -Custom sprites like nothing you have ever seen. I have already made a crapload of sprites and the list is going to climb. Enjoy my creations.

    -A great and innovative map set. I've put a lot of effort into my custom maps and I've worked hard to make sure my stock maps are personalized and interactive too. I've been creative with map layers and what items can be seen as.

    -The wholes things open and unlocked so you can just poke it open and take a gander at how I did it. You wana know how I did something then just check it out for yourself and try to make it on your own.
